Council defers SK request for P1-M aid

THE Cebu City Council has deferred the approval of the nine resolutions that will supposedly allow the granting of P1 million each as financial assistance to the Sangguniang Kabataan (SK) in nine barangays.

During the deliberation of the resolutions sponsored by Councilor Jessica Resch, who sits as ex-officio member of the council being the SK Federation president, Councilor Jocelyn Pesquera questioned some of the items in the proposal.

Pesquera said that for Barangay Tabunan alone, a paint was estimated to cost P10,000.

“I’m not against the activity or giving assistance to the barangay (SK). However, in terms of the costing, I’m afraid that we will be accused for overpricing,” she said.

Pesquera said she believes the prices in the proposal were jacked up to reach P1 million, which is one of the requirement to get financial assistance.

In response, Resch said prices were just estimates and all disbursement will follow the needed procedures.

She also assured that any procurement will go through a bidding in City Hall.

The matter prompted members of the Council to agree to defer for a week the approval of the resolutions while clarification is being sought.

Apart from Tabunan, SKs in Barangays Tejero, Bonbon, Toong, Sambag I, Kinasang-an, Punta Princesa, Sapangdaku and Babag also submitted their proposals to get the P1 million financial aid.

But even before the proposals of the nine barangays, other SKs of the other city barangays also submitted their proposals. They were approved by the council.

These include the SKs in Barangays Budlaan, Guadalupe, Busay, Kasambagan, Sawang Calero, T. Padilla, and Talamban.

Resch earlier said SKs in the barangays would have to submit their project proposals to get the financial assistance.

The aid is Mayor Tomas Osmeña’s election promise to the youth leaders.

Osmeña earlier promised that he would fund SK projects worth at least P1 million in exchange for their support in electing a federation president who will support his administration. (RVC)
